ARMAGH Posted 26 January , 2012 Share Posted 26 January , 2012 Second Officer Lee Rice who died of illness in Armagh contracted while serving in Mesopotamia. Born 5 April 1889 son of John Rice Mullinure Co Armagh Merchant Service Head Line,then, Joined Royal Naval Transport Service in the war. was given a military funeral,reported in the local papers,was buried in St Mark,s Church graveyard Armagh 29 7 1917. Age 27 have Looked for his Service Records on which ships he served etc, but no luck. Any member going to Kew? Maybe a kind Forum chum could look for his service records? We are trying to gather enough evidence,when he be came ill? and where and if on a ship,so as we can bring this sailor in from the cold. Can any one help?
